## Runbook: Pushing builds to the Marrowgate partner drop

Hey plugin folks — once your build passes the Glintworks validator, zip it with the manifest at the root (not in a subfolder, the ingester is picky). Drop it into your assigned SFTP folder before the 18:00 cutoff; anything later rolls to the next day's batch. The ingester rejects unsigned archives outright, so sign before you upload, no exceptions. Naming convention is plugin-name, version, date, same as always. Sign your archive with the partner key below.

release key, fahaf-bajof: bky3_Xam

It reports each
# restart to the Fernhollow telemetry collector, and that report must be
# authenticated or the collector silently drops it, which makes incident
# review impossible. Do not ship a build without verifying this file. All
# non-secret values live above; the authenticated reporting credential comes
# next. The required line is the following.

vault entry, yahif-yajep: COURIER_KEY29=b802bdf8034096b65a51c6ba5abe2

# Break-Glass: Catalog Cache Invalidation

Scope: the Pinrow product catalog at Veldstone Retail. If stale prices persist after a purge and the Hollowmere invalidation queue is wedged, use break-glass to flush the edge tier directly. Contractors: get verbal sign-off from the catalog lead first. Steps: open the Hollowmere admin shell, select emergency-flush, confirm the tenant, and run it once — repeated flushes thrash the origin. Access is logged and expires after 20 minutes. Unseal the admin shell with the passphrase below.

recovery phrase for kahop-tajog: istix-casvan

As discussed at last week's sync, the telemetry gateway on the Fenwick cluster now authenticates to the ingest broker with a rotated secret rather than the shared fleet key. After deploying the 2.9 gateway image, confirm that tractors in the Harrowdale test fleet reconnect within the 90-second grace window before proceeding. Rotation will fail silently if the broker credential is missing, so before restarting the gateway service, append the broker secret to /etc/plowline/gateway.env immediately below this sentence.

vault entry, yajop-bafop: ARCHIVE_KEY3=8d4